Welcome to Bayou Heights Hanlons, a hidden gem nestled in the heart of St. Petersburg, Florida. This charming subdivision offers a perfect blend of tranquility and convenience, making it an ideal setting for families, retirees, and everyone in between. With its lush landscapes and friendly atmosphere, Bayou Heights Hanlons is more than just a neighborhood; it’s a community where neighbors become friends.

Located in the vibrant Pinellas County, Bayou Heights Hanlons is just a stone’s throw away from the beautiful Gulf Coast beaches, renowned for their soft sands and stunning sunsets. Residents enjoy easy access to a variety of outdoor activities, including boating, fishing, and hiking in the nearby parks. The area is also known for its rich cultural scene, with art galleries, theaters, and lively festivals that showcase the best of St. Petersburg’s local talent.

The homes in Bayou Heights Hanlons are characterized by their unique architectural styles and well-manicured lawns, creating an inviting atmosphere that welcomes you home. With a range of housing options, from cozy single-family homes to larger estates, there’s something for everyone in this picturesque community.

Families will appreciate the proximity to highly-rated schools, as well as the numerous parks and recreational facilities that cater to all ages. Shopping, dining, and entertainment options are just minutes away, providing residents with everything they need to enjoy a fulfilling lifestyle.

$380,000
2 Beds 1 Baths Bayou Heights Hanlons SubDv. 33705 Zip Code
Big personality, generous outdoor space and a setting that instantly feels like home—this Bayou Heights property makes a memorable first impression. With 1,310 square feet of living space on a deep 50-by-150-foot homesite, natural stone accents, a covered front porch, carport, broad driveway and magnificent mature shade tree introduce a home with far more space and character than expected. Soft neutral tones, crown molding, paneled wainscoting, and wood-look laminate flooring create a cohesive backdrop throughout the main living areas. The dining area is filled with natural light from two large windows and finished with a contemporary linear chandelier. Its open connection to the kitchen and living room keeps the floor plan visually connected while allowing each space to retain its own character. The 19-foot galley kitchen, renovated in 2019, combines Shaker-style cabinetry, granite countertops, a mosaic-tile backsplash, stainless-steel appliances, and a generous double-door pantry. An extended work surface provides abundant room for preparation, while the undermount sink, high-arc spring faucet, and wide window add function and light. The living room easily accommodates multiple zones for seating, media, work, or hobbies. Broad windows, two ceiling fans, and sliding glass doors reinforce its open proportions and connect the room directly to the screened porch. The spacious primary bedroom features a modern ceiling fan and a dedicated space for a closet and dressing area with built-in cabinetry. The wood-burning fireplace is framed by dramatic natural stone and a substantial mantel. Bedroom two includes natural light and sliding glass doors opening directly to the porch. The full bathroom, renovated in 2019, offers a vanity with an undermount sink, contemporary lighting, additional wall-mounted storage, and a tub-and-shower combination. A dedicated laundry closet houses the included full-size front-loading washer and dryer. The screened porch expands the full length of the home with a substantial covered outdoor area featuring tile flooring, a ceiling fan, natural stonework, and space for separate seating and dining. The private pool is surrounded by an expansive paver deck, with a privacy fence, open lawn, and storage shed completing the backyard. The pool has a new-2025 pool pump, filter and new liner! This block/stucco built property is located in a Flood Zone X with no HOA or CDD. Boyd Hill Nature Preserve, Lake Maggiore, city parks, downtown St. Petersburg’s waterfront, Gulf beaches, shopping, dining, and major roadways are all within convenient reach. The result is a home that delivers generous interior proportions, flexible living space, a private pool, and distinctive features in an established St. Petersburg neighborhood.

5210 6th Street S, St Petersburg
